German shooting club festivals and coronations

Overview

Traditional shooting festivals and coronation ceremonies were held by local clubs in the Düsseldorf area.

In Urdenbach, the Bürger-Schützenverein celebrated new royalty after Inka Garn shot the king bird and her daughter, Laura Garn, shot the prince bird. Due to achieving the title of prince for a third time, Laura Garn was designated as ‘Kaiser’ (Emperor).

In Unterbach, the St. Hubertus Schützenbruderschaft 1870 conducted a four-day festival. Gerhard Fuhrmann secured the kingship for a third time, earning the title of ‘Schützenkaiser’. The festivities included music, parades, and community events, with Lars and Sabine Schweden serving as the reigning royal pair during the event.
